Glen Alexander Sheppard of Blenheim passed away on Tuesday February 5, 2018 at the Chatham-Kent Hospice. Glen was born in Hamilton 55 years ago to Madeleine & the late George Sheppard. He will always remain in the hearts of his children Regan, Maclean and Graem Sheppard and their mother Lori.

Glen was one of seven siblings and is survived by his sisters Paullette Henderson (Wayne) and Rita Browe (late Jim) and by his brothers John Sheppard and Al Sheppard (Kelly). He was predeceased by his brothers Mark and Tim Sheppard.

There were many things that Glen loved in life…he was an avid cyclist, he loved music, he curled, he loved the outdoors and his job in the produce department at Sobeys in Chatham. However, there was nothing he loved more than spending time with the three people who were the most important to him and made him so proud…his children.

In keeping with his wishes, cremation has taken place. His family will celebrate his life at a later date. Blenheim Community Funeral Home entrusted with funeral arrangements.

Friends wishing to remember Glen with a memorial donation are asked to consider the Word of Life Soup Kitchen.
